Portable transdermal administration patch apparatus and preparation method thereof

A portable transdermal administration patch apparatus comprises a communication control device and a pharmaceutical device which is fixed to and arranged at a lower end of the communication control device and electrically connected to the communication control device. The communication control device is formed of a micro-battery, a wireless control device and a micro-controller which are electrically connected. The preparation of the patch apparatus is achieved by: the preparation of medicinal patches and non-medicinal patches, the mounting of electrodes, interfacing with a micro-controller, and the communication control system, and starting administration. The transdermal apparatus is wearable and can be remotely controlled, and is convenient for administration, in particular, for the situations of daily administration for elderly patients with chronic illness and when there are a larger number of admitted inpatients, where a nurse can pre-set the administration time and dose, thus saving time and efforts of medical staff.

COMBINED LOCAL DELIVERY OF THERAPEUTIC AGENTS USING INTERVENTIONAL DEVICES AND RADIATION
20230056047 · 2023-02-23 ·

A method and system for combination therapy utilizing local drug delivery and radiotherapy at a target site of body tissue are provided. The delivery system comprises a source electrode adapted to be positioned proximate to a target site of internal body tissue. A counter electrode is in electrical communication with the source electrode, and is configured to cooperate with the source electrode to form a localized electric field proximate to the target site. A cargo may be delivered to the target site when exposed to the localized electric field. Radiotherapy is applied to the target site in combination with the local drug delivery.

GENE GUN
20220362473 · 2022-11-17 ·

An accelerator module is connected to an initiator module and generates supersonic waves from subsonic waves generated by the initiator module. The supersonic waves deliver particles to cells in tissues. The accelerator module may include a knocking-detonation transition metal and a detonation material. An example of the knocking-detonation transition metal is copper (I) 5-nitrotetrazolate. Another example of the knocking-detonation transition metal is lead azide. An example of the detonation material is pentaerythritol tetranitrate (PETN).

Ultrasonic medicine application device that strongly promotes medicine absorption
11491285 · 2022-11-08 ·

An ultrasonic medicine application device that strongly promotes medicine absorption, having a housing, a control panel and a circuit board inside the housing, a medicine supply mechanism and an ultrasonic massage mechanism on a bottom surface of the housing. The ultrasonic massage mechanism has a base panel having massage projections, and also an electrical ultrasonic vibration element, which drives the projections make high frequency ultrasonic vibration. The medicine supply mechanism is positioned between the ultrasonic massage mechanism and the circuit board, and is configured to supply medicine towards the ultrasonic massage mechanism.
